L. Marijanovic, S. Schwarz, M. Rupp:
"Multi-user Resource Allocation for Low Latency Communications based on Mixed Numerology";
Vortrag: VTC Fall 2019, Honolulu, Hawaii; 22.09.2019 - 25.09.2019; in: "VTC Fall", IEEE, (2019).



Kurzfassung deutsch:
In this paper, we propose an optimization method for resource and numerology allocation in multi-user scenarios. We focus on the achievement of packet latency constraints in low latency communications as one of the fundamental service requirements in 5G. We consider two groups of users: low latency users that impose a latency constraint and conventional, non-low latency users that do not impose a latency constraint. Furthermore, we consider users with varying channel conditions characterized by their delay and Doppler spread. Additionally, our optimization includes the effects of channel estimation and inter-numerology interference. The optimization problem is formulated as a multiscenario max-min Knapsack problem and it is given by an integer programming solution.
